Amelia is a playable unit in Fire Emblem: The Sacred Stones and one of the three trainee units in the game.

Background

Raised in Silva, a small village in the countryside of Grado, Amelia lived alone with her mother. Her father had died early when she was young and eventually her mother became extremely ill. When Amelia was still a child, there was a bandit raid on her village. While she hid in terror under the bed, her mother Melina was captured by the bandits. With her mother assumed dead, Amelia dedicated herself to becoming stronger and when she was old enough, joined the Grado army as a new recruit, choosing the spear as a weapon.

While she was in the border town of Serafew preparing to join the army, she had a chance encounter with Eirika, though only in passing and neither spoke to one another. During Eirika's route, Amelia is sent on her first mission at Port Kiris in Carcino on the front lines. However she was convinced to change sides when Eirika or Franz talked to her. In Ephraim's path, Amelia encounters his party at Fort Rigwald. After being treated miserably by her commanding officer, Gheb, she is convinced by Ephraim or Franz to join the Renais army. She continued to fight on the side of the Renais royals until the end of the war.

Possible Fates

Amelia has five different endings, depending on whether he reaches A-Support with Franz, Ross, Ewan, or Duessel.

  • Default Ending - After the war, she returned to Grado and worked to rebuild the country. She found new friends and the strength she gained from the battlefield brought her happiness.
  • Amelia and Franz Ending - Following the war, Franz brought Amelia home with him to Renais. Though she joined the army for a time, she eventually retired her commission and married him. They had a daughter who grew to become a great knight like her parents.
  • Amelia and Ross Ending - Ross brought Amelia to his hometown and eventually she decided to stay. As time went on, the two eventually fell in love and were married. They would later have a son that grew up to be a great warrior like Ross, eventually surpassing him.
  • Amelia and Ewan Ending - With the war over, the two set out as they had promised and visited sights all over Magvel. As they traveled, the deeds they performed made them small legends. In time they settled down and together had a daughter.
  • Amelia and Duessel Ending - After returning to Grado, Duessel led Amelia to her mother. After a tearful reunion, Amelia stayed by Duessel's side and become his most trusted companion.

Support Conversation Summaries

Amelia is capable of support conversations with five other characters.

  • Ross - In the first conversation, Amelia trips and accidentally hurts Ross, and he begins to attack her but she denies being a Grado soldier anymore. Ross eventually comes to believe this and that her "surprise attack" was an accident, and realizes that she has all the markings of a rookie soldier so he offers to protect her from hazing. In return he only demands she help him against enemies with swords, and she agrees, then thanks Ross for believing her. In the next conversation they exchange names and Ross says she has been improving and that he remembers what it's like to be a rookie. He assures her that they will both continue to improve and advance through the ranks. Ross then gives her a necklace that he bought long ago, although Amelia accepts it with reluctance. She says this is because she lived a modest life and could not afford something like that she considered everything precious and did not want Ross to part with something that was precious to him, although he assures her that it will be fine and jokes that he looks better with earrings than necklaces. In the final conversation, he checks up on Amelia and while talking about his aspirations comes to describe his father and then asks Amelia about her family. She briefly describes her parents' situations, which causes Ross to feel sorry about bring up something so painful. However, he immediately attempts to amend this by saying that he will be her new older brother due to the army being like a family. Amelia questions this because she thinks that they are the same age and in fact she might be older, which comes to anger Ross, although she finds his anger cute. He says he will take her to his village after the war because they are brother and sister and will share both joy and sorrow as a family. Amelia notes that this sounds like a proposal, but Ross in turn accuses her of mixing up his words.
  • Neimi - Neimi greets Amelia be pointing the lovely shade her armor is and how it reminds her of a certain berry that grew in her hometown, the two end up befriending one another and decide to meet again soon. The two later talk about why Amelia joined the army, which Amelia says was because she used to feel helpless and didn't want to feel that way. Neimi comments that she received her training from her grandfather and ends up talking about a pet fox she used to own, prompting Amelia to talk about a bird she used to own. In their final conversation, the two begin talking about different men that they are interested in. Neimi alludes to the fact she's in love with Colm, though Amelia is less revealing about the man she's interested in.
